Atlanta (ATL) to Del Rio (DRT)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Hartsfield - Jackson Atlanta International Airport (ATL) in Atlanta, United States to Del Rio International Airport (DRT) in Del Rio, United States is 1,633 kilometers (1,014 miles / 882 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 3h, flying west southwest at a heading of 258°.
